VTEC System
- The VTEC system changes the cam profile to correspond to engine speed. It maximizes torque at low engine speed and output at high engine speed.
- The low lift cam is used at low engine speeds, and the high lift cam is used at high engine speeds.
- The rocker arm oil control solenoid switches the VTEC system on and off; the solenoid is controlled by the PCM.
- The rocker arm oil pressure switch detects VTEC system oil pressure and sends this information to the PCM.ENGINE SPEED CHART
